			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>According to the US Department of Energy (<a href="http://www.eia.doe.gov/oiaf/ieo/world.html" target="_blank">Energy Information Administration</a>), the world consumption of energy in all of its forms (barrels of petroleum, cubic meters of natural gas, watts of hydro power, etc.) is projected to reach 678 quadrillion Btu by 2030 – a 44% increase over 2008 levels. That&#8217;s a lot of energy. Saw <a href="http://www.landartgenerator.org/blagi/archives/127" target="_blank"><strong>this really interesting article</strong></a> that tries to project the total surface area required to fuel that 2030 world with ONLY SOLAR PANELS!</p>
<p>Below is a surprisingly sparse diagram. It&#8217;s kind of amazing to me how small the little squares are!
